Understanding the Coupe Car Plug-In Hybrid
A coupe car plug-in hybrid isn’t just another car; it’s a carefully engineered fusion. At its core, it’s a two-door vehicle, characterized by its sloping roofline and sportier aesthetic. The “plug-in hybrid” aspect means it combines a traditional internal combustion engine (ICE) with an electric motor and a battery pack that can be recharged by plugging it into an external power source. This setup offers the best of both worlds: zero-emission electric driving for daily commutes and the extended range and power of a gasoline engine for longer journeys.
The key differentiator from a standard hybrid is the ability to charge the battery externally. This larger battery capacity allows for a significant electric-only driving range, often exceeding 30 miles, and sometimes much more. This means you can potentially complete your entire daily commute without using a drop of gasoline, greatly reducing your fuel costs and environmental impact. When the battery is depleted, or when you need maximum power for acceleration or highway cruising, the gasoline engine seamlessly kicks in, acting much like a conventional hybrid system.

Diving into PHEV Technology
The magic of a plug-in hybrid coupe lies in its powertrain. It’s a sophisticated dance between electric and gasoline power. Here’s a breakdown of the core components:
- Internal Combustion Engine (ICE): A traditional gasoline engine, typically designed for efficiency and performance.
- Electric Motor(s): Provides silent, emission-free propulsion and can also assist the gasoline engine for enhanced acceleration.
- Battery Pack: A relatively large lithium-ion battery that stores electrical energy. Its size dictates the electric-only driving range.
- Charging Port: Allows you to plug the car into a wall outlet or dedicated charging station to replenish the battery.
- Power Control Unit: The “brain” of the system, managing the flow of energy between the engine, motor, and battery for optimal efficiency and performance.
This integration allows the driver to select different driving modes, such as EV-only, Hybrid mode (where the car automatically blends power sources), or even a battery-charge mode to preserve electric power for later use.

Instant Torque and Smooth Acceleration
The immediate availability of power from the electric motor is a game-changer. Unlike a gasoline engine that needs to rev up to reach its peak torque, an electric motor delivers its maximum torque from 0 RPM. This translates into a sensation of effortless, immediate acceleration that feels both exciting and refined. Pulling away from traffic lights or merging onto a busy highway becomes a smooth, confident experience. This characteristic is particularly noticeable in a lighter, sportier chassis like that of a coupe.

Fuel Economy and Cost Savings
When driven predominantly on electricity, the fuel costs can be dramatically reduced. Charging at home, especially during off-peak hours, is considerably cheaper than buying gasoline. For drivers with predictable daily commutes within the electric range, it’s possible to go weeks or months without visiting a gas station. Even on longer trips, the PHEV system optimizes fuel usage, often achieving impressive MPG figures that surpass traditional gasoline coupes.
Consider the potential savings:
| Scenario | Estimated Monthly Fuel Cost (Gasoline Coupe) | Estimated Monthly Fuel Cost (PHEV Coupe – Primarily Electric) |
|---|---|---|
| Daily Commute (30 miles round trip, 20 days/month) | $150 – $250 | $20 – $40 (electricity cost) |
| Occasional Longer Trips (500 miles/month, mixed driving) | $100 – $150 | $70 – $100 (mixed gasoline/electricity) |
Note: These are illustrative estimates. Actual costs will vary based on local electricity and gasoline prices, driving habits, and vehicle efficiency ratings.

Charging Time and Infrastructure
While you can charge a PHEV using a standard household outlet (Level 1 charging), this can take a considerable amount of time, often overnight or longer, to fully replenish the battery. For more practical charging, especially if you want to top up during the day or ensure daily readiness, a Level 2 charger installed at home or work is highly recommended. This can typically charge the battery in 2-4 hours. Public charging stations are also becoming more prevalent, offering convenient charging opportunities on the go. Understanding your charging needs and the available infrastructure is key to optimizing the PHEV experience.

Hybrid System Maintenance
The hybrid components, particularly the battery and electric motor, are designed for longevity and typically require minimal direct maintenance. Manufacturers often offer extensive warranties on these components, providing peace of mind. Regular servicing of the gasoline engine, as you would for any traditional car, is crucial. The regenerative braking system, which captures energy during deceleration to recharge the battery, can also reduce wear on the conventional friction brakes, potentially leading to longer brake life.
- Regular Oil Changes: For the gasoline engine.
- Tire Rotation and Balancing: Standard for any vehicle.
- Brake System Checks: While less wear, periodic checks are still necessary.
- Coolant Levels: Ensure both engine and battery cooling systems are at optimal levels.
- Software Updates: Keep the vehicle’s control units up-to-date for optimal performance and efficiency.
Battery Health and Longevity
Modern hybrid battery packs are built to last the life of the vehicle, often warrantied for 8-10 years or 100,000+ miles. Battery management systems within the car actively monitor and regulate the battery’s temperature and charge cycles to maximize its lifespan. While extreme temperatures can affect battery performance, manufacturers design systems to mitigate these effects. For most owners, the battery’s long-term health is not a significant concern during typical ownership periods.
Understanding Driving Modes
Familiarize yourself with the different driving modes available on your PHEV. These typically include:
- EV Mode: Uses only electric power until the battery charge is depleted or the driver demands maximum acceleration.
- Hybrid Mode: The vehicle intelligently switches between or combines electric and gasoline power for optimal efficiency and performance.
- Charge Mode: Uses the gasoline engine to charge the battery, useful if you anticipate needing full electric range later.
- Sport Mode: Often prioritizes performance, utilizing both power sources more aggressively for enhanced acceleration.
Selecting the appropriate mode for your driving situation can significantly impact your experience and efficiency.
FAQ: Coupe Car Plug-In Hybrid
Q1: What is a coupe car plug-in hybrid?
A: It’s a two-door, sporty car that combines a gasoline engine with an electric motor and a rechargeable battery, allowing for electric-only driving and extended range with gasoline power.
Q2: How far can a coupe PHEV drive on electric power alone?
A: Most current models offer an electric-only range of 25 to 50 miles, with some newer or premium models exceeding this.
Q3: Is a PHEV coupe more expensive than a regular gasoline coupe?
A: Generally, yes, the initial purchase price is higher due to the advanced technology. However, government incentives and long-term fuel savings can offset this cost.
Q4: How do I charge a coupe PHEV?
A: You can charge it using a standard wall outlet (Level 1), a dedicated home Level 2 charger (recommended for faster charging), or at public charging stations.
Q5: Will a PHEV coupe still provide good performance?
A: Yes, the instant torque from the electric motor often enhances acceleration. Many PHEV coupes offer a thrilling driving experience with combined horsepower from both power sources.
Q6: Is the battery in a PHEV coupe covered by a warranty?
A: Absolutely. Manufacturers typically provide a long warranty for the hybrid battery pack, often covering it for 8-10 years or over 100,000 miles.
Q7: What’s the difference between a hybrid and a plug-in hybrid coupe?
A: A standard hybrid’s battery is charged only by the engine and regenerative braking. A plug-in hybrid has a larger battery that can also be charged by plugging into an external power source, enabling a significant all-electric driving range.
